      <p>When Norwegian artist Morten Traavik traveled to North Korea, he met 
        students from the Pyongyang Kum Song School of Music and gave them a CD 
        of Euro-pop group <a href="http://a-ha.com/">a-ha</a>. The students surprised 
        him by performing &quot;Take On Me&quot; on accordions.</p>
      <p>From <a href="http://blogs.wsj.com/korearealtime/2012/02/05/north-korean-accordians-80s-pop-video-gold/">Korea 
        Realtime blog</a> over at The Wall Street Journal:</p>
      <blockquote>
        <p><em>After giving the students the CD on a Monday night, they surprised 
          him by playing their own improvised version of &#8220;Take On Me&#8221; 
          on Wednesday morning. Mr. Traavik made a video of them and decided to 
          post it on YouTube to promote the festival. Since he put it up on Thursday, 
          the video has gone viral, passed along by North Korea watchers and others 
          mystified or intrigued by the idea of musicians in a collective society 
          with traditional instruments playing one of the classics of 1980s Euro-pop.</em></p>
        <p><em>Mr. Traavik said he&#8217;s noticed the video has attracted the 
          normal skepticism about its origins and whether the musicians were threatened 
          to learn the music or secretly dislike it. He said he views them as 
          normal artists who, skilled at their instrument, did what was natural 
          when presented with something they liked &#8211; tried to re-create 
          it.</em></p>
        <p><em>&#8220;I think it&#8217;s quite evident from the video that you 
          can&#8217;t accomplish that in such a time if you would suppose those 
          young musicians actually hate what they&#8217;re doing,&#8221; he said.</em></p>

<p>Just because you need an emergency tent it doesn&#8217;t mean that you have to live in an unstylish one. Here&#8217;s the Accordion reCover Shelter, by designers Matthew Malone, Amanda Goldberg, Jennifer Metcalf and Grant Meacham: </p>
<blockquote><p><em>There&#8217;s nothing flimsy about the intricate folds of the reCover Shelter, which can sustain a family of four following a disaster for up to a month. As you may suspect, the oversized origami structure can be entirely collapsed into not one, but two different shapes (either horse-shoe or flat) depending on which is easier to transport. Plus, it&#8217;s composed of polypropylene, meaning no harmful gases go into the production of the shelter and it is 100% recyclable after use. Set-up takes minutes and only requires one person on deck.</em></p>
<p><em>The Accordion reCover Shelter was designed as a first response shelter &#8211; &#8220;something that could be transported to the site when infrastructures such as roads were unusable&#8221;. Once the temporary residence is unfolded, the functional ridges can be used to collect drinking water, and local materials or even ground cover can be used to better insulate the structure and keep harsh weather at bay. As a sustainable and inexpensive solution to an unfortunate situation that seems to arise more and more often these days, the Accordion Shelter provides a quick roof over victim&#8217;s heads and lets them start planning immediately for better days to come.</em></p>
